Another area to consider is soil breakdown. You might be able to leave the tree in a larger pot for a couple of years more, but if the soil breaks down (including akadama, Turface, etc), you will need to repot anyway. The reason to use a grow box is to improve the health of the tree, not to make it easier on you (not needing to repot when necessary). As one of my former club members says "Do you use a pot, soil, watering regime to benefit you or the tree?"
